About Carmelo Cascone

Carmelo Cascone is a scholar working on Computer Networks and Communications, Electrical and Electronic Engineering, Control and Systems Engineering, Oncology and Surgery, having authored 21 papers that have together received 596 indexed citations. Recurring topics across this work include Software-Defined Networks and 5G (16 papers), Advanced Optical Network Technologies (6 papers), Network Traffic and Congestion Control (6 papers), Caching and Content Delivery (3 papers), Radiation Effects in Electronics (3 papers), Smart Grid Security and Resilience (3 papers), Interconnection Networks and Systems (3 papers) and Network Security and Intrusion Detection (3 papers). The work is most often cited by research in Computer Networks and Communications (567 citations), Hardware and Architecture (67 citations), Electrical and Electronic Engineering (232 citations), Information Systems (90 citations) and Software (8 citations). Carmelo Cascone has collaborated with scholars based in Italy, United States and Canada. Frequent co-authors include Marco Bonola, Antonio Capone, Giuseppe Bianchi, Antonio Capone, Davide Sanvito, Brunilde Sansò, Salvatore Pontarelli, Roberto Bifulco, Michio Honda and Giuseppe Siracusano. Their work appears in journals such as ACM SIGCOMM Computer Communication Review, Digestive and Liver Disease, International Journal of Network Management, e_Buah and PolyPublie (École Polytechnique de Montréal).
